**Understanding the Topic**
Brown butter sweet potato pie is a delightful twist on the classic pumpkin pie, with the addition of nutty brown butter enhancing the sweet and earthy flavors of the sweet potatoes. The process of browning butter involves cooking it until the milk solids turn a deep golden brown, imparting a toasty and caramel-like flavor to the dish. When combined with the creamy sweet potato filling and warm spices like cinnamon and nutmeg, the result is a decadent dessert that is perfect for fall and winter gatherings.
**Common Pitfalls or Mistakes**
One common mistake when making brown butter sweet potato pie is not allowing the brown butter to cool before adding it to the filling. If the butter is too hot, it can cause the eggs in the filling to curdle, resulting in a lumpy texture. To avoid this, be sure to let the brown butter cool slightly before incorporating it into the other ingredients.
Another pitfall to watch out for is overmixing the filling. Once the eggs are added, be sure to mix the filling just until everything is combined. Overmixing can incorporate too much air into the filling, leading to a puffy and uneven texture in the finished pie.

**Step-by-Step Recipe or Instructions**
Now that we’ve covered some background information, let’s dive into the step-by-step instructions for making a delicious brown butter sweet potato pie.
Ingredients:
– 2 medium sweet potatoes
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ter
– 3/4 cup brown sugar
– 2 eggs
– 1/2 cup milk
–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
– 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
– 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
– 1/4 teaspoon salt
– 1 unbaked pie crust
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
2. Peel and chop the sweet potatoes into small cubes. Boil them in a pot of water until they are fork-tender, about 15-20 minutes. Drain and mash the sweet potatoes until smooth.
3. In a small sa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Continue to cook the butter, swirling the pan occasionally, until it turns a deep golden brown and smells nutty, about 5-7 minutes. Be careful not to burn the butter.
4. In a large mixing bowl, combine the mashed sweet potatoes, brown sugar, brown butter, eggs, milk, vanilla extract,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t. Mix until smooth and well combined.
5. Pour the filling into the unbaked pie crust and smooth the top with a spatula.
6. Bake the pie in the preheated oven for 50-60 minutes, or until the filling is set and the crust is golden brown.
7. Allow the pie to cool completely before serving. Enjoy with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
**Budget Kitchen Tip 💡**
One smart habit that pays off: Save your sweet potato peels to make crispy sweet potato skins. Toss the peels with olive oil, salt, and your favorite seasonings, then bake in a hot oven until crispy.
